Introduction
Monquest L Syrup is a medication primarily used in children to alleviate symptoms of allergies, including runny nose, sneezing, itching, swelling, congestion, and watery eyes. Additionally, it can be beneficial in managing asthma and skin allergies. The syrup contains Levocetirizine and Montelukast, which work together to relieve allergy symptoms by blocking chemical messengers responsible for inflammation and allergic reactions. While generally safe, it is important to follow the prescribed dosage and consult a healthcare provider for any concerns.

How it works
Monquest L Syrup contains Levocetirizine and Montelukast. Levocetirizine is an antiallergic that blocks histamine, a chemical messenger responsible for runny nose, watery eyes, and sneezing. Montelukast is a leukotriene antagonist that blocks leukotriene, another chemical messenger, reducing inflammation in the airways and nose, thereby improving symptoms.
Quick Tips
Never combine Monquest L Syrup with other cold and flu medicines as that may have side effects. Monquest L Syrup helps prevent asthma attacks. Never use it to stop an attack that has already started as it will not help. If you are giving Monquest L Syrup to your child for asthma or allergy, you need not give another dose to prevent exercise-induced breathing problems. In case of any confusion, consult your child’s doctor as soon as possible. Make sure that you always have enough medicine. Practice self-care tips: Abstain your child from coming in contact with allergens, encourage your child to wear a face mask and avoid dusty places, give plenty of fluids as it helps in thinning and loosening the mucus in the lungs.
